Abstract

The utility model provides a kind of electric pressure cooking saucepan, including:The jacket of pot body, lid and microswitch, pot body is equipped with heavy platform, and heavy platform has the first end wall and the second end wall along jacket radial direction, is formed on the first end wall of heavy platform and skids off notch;Lid can detach or cover conjunction with pot body, and the lower surface of lid is equipped with limit convex closure, and limit convex closure is inserted into heavy platform and can be slided along the circumferential direction of jacket in heavy platform, and limit convex closure can skid off heavy platform by skidding off barbed portion;Microswitch is mounted in heavy platform, and when limit convex closure is inserted into heavy platform and limits the spacing between convex closure and the second end wall of heavy platform more than preset value, microswitch is limited convex closure and presses and be off always.Above-mentioned technical proposal, limit convex closure can skid off heavy platform by skidding off barbed portion, to ensure limit convex closure with sufficiently large sliding stroke, it is ensured that under the premise of folding lid safety, reduce the width of jacket heavy platform, promote the cosmetic look of product.

Background technology
Existing jacket convex closure structure, as depicted in figs. 1 and 2, since microswitch 30' is normal open state, to meet The safety requirements of pressure cooker product, upper cap assembly is during screwing when being only more than certain value with the fastening amount of outer pot pot tooth Microswitch could be normal open state, and microswitch needs to disconnect in the rotary course less than this value, and product cannot lead to Electricity, therefore in the security performance to meet product, jacket when coordinating with upper cap assembly, on jacket with upper cap assembly convex closure The jacket convex closure 20' of 10' cooperations is oversized, causes the appearance of product entirety uncoordinated, leverages the aesthetic feeling of product, To reduce the desire to purchase of consumer, product competition dynamics is caused to decline.

Preferably, heavy platform 101 is more than along the ratio of jacket 10 circumferential width and the periphery circumference of jacket 10 30 °/360 ° and be less than or equal to 45 °/360 °.
The rotation angle of lid is 30 ° or so when being commonly designed folding lid in the prior art, and matched jacket is convex Packet accounts for 50 °/360 ° or so of the periphery circumference of jacket along the width of jacket circumferential direction so that the size of jacket convex closure Greatly, unsightly;In above-mentioned technical proposal, since the limit convex closure 21 on lid 20 can be by the cunning of the heavy platform 101 of jacket 10 Go out 104 part of notch and skid off heavy platform 101, therefore heavy platform 101 is very big without designing along the circumferential width dimensions of jacket 10, just It can ensure that pot cover buckle teeth and outer pot pot tooth have sufficiently large fastening amount, and ensure to have with outer pot pot tooth in pot cover buckle teeth sufficiently large Fastening amount before, microswitch 30 be limited always convex closure 21 press and be off, it is ensured that the safety of folding lid Property;Preferably, design heavy platform 101 along the ratio of the circumferential width of jacket 10 and the periphery circumference of jacket 10 be more than 30 °/ 360 ° and be less than or equal to 45 °/360 °, the width dimensions to avoid heavy platform 101 it is too small and cannot be guaranteed lid 20 have with pot body Sufficiently large fastening amount, while avoiding the width dimensions of heavy platform 101 excessive and influencing the cosmetic look of product.
Specifically, heavy platform 101 along the ratio of the circumferential width of jacket 10 and the periphery circumference of jacket 10 be 32 °/ 360°、35°/360°、37°/360°、40°/360°、42°/360°、45°/360°.Certainly, heavy platform 101 is circumferential along jacket 10 Width dimensions be not limited to above-mentioned specific restriction, can be rationally designed according to the size of actual product, without departing from this The design concept of utility model, should be within the protection scope of the present utility model.
